Yesterday was the first part of my motorcycling adventure; the CBT.
CBT (Compulsary Basic Training) is a standard you must achieve before you can ride a motorbike on the road in the UK.
Thanks to Ian and Ivan at Excel Rider Training who made the day; despite the weather!
The next step to to practice my theory and hazard perception tests, then book a theory and see where we go. Until then I could look into the purchase of a 125cc bike and ride on the road with the L plates.
